Captain

Definition: The captain is the highest level officer on a cruise ship. He/she is responsible for steering the ship or directing others who drive it. The captain is the ultimate commander on a ship, and all the officers and high-level civilians such as the hotel director act under his direction.
Also Known As: master of the ship
Examples: The captain of the cruise ship directed the pilot to steer the ship into the harbor.
